Ensaymada

Description

A traditional Filipino snack can easily be recreated in your home. When making this snack, keep in mind that you can never have it rise too long. The longer you rise the dough for, the ensaymada will be even fluffier.

Ingredients

  • 1 ½ tablespoons active dry yeast
  • 1 tablespoon white sugar
  • 1 cup warm water, divided
  • 8 egg yolks
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our, or more as needed
  • 1 cup white sugar
  • 1 cup melted butter, divided
  • ½ cup milk
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on melted butter, or as needed
  • 1 tablespoon white sugar, or as needed
  • ¼ cup grated Cheddar cheese, or as needed

Instructions

  1. Dissolve yeast and 1 tablespoon sugar in 1/2 cup water.
  2. Combine remaining water
  3. egg yolks
  4. flour
  5. 1 cup sugar
  6. 2/3 cup melted butter
  7. milk
  8. and salt in a bowl. Stir in yeast mixture until a dough forms. Transfer to a floured surface and knead until dough is smooth
  9. elastic
  10. and no longer sticky
  11. adding more flour as needed.
  12. Place dough into a greased bowl and let rise until doubled in size
  13. about 2 hours.
  14.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  15. Divide dough into 1-ounce balls. Roll out each ball into a thin rectangle and brush with remaining 1/3 cup melted butter. Roll dough lengthwise and shape. Place onto a baking sheet. Cover and let rise until light and dough is soft
  16. about 30 minutes.
  17. Bake in the preheated oven until golden brown and easy to pick up off of the baking sheet
  18. about 15 minutes.
  19. Remove from the oven and brush warm tops with melted butter
  20. dust with sugar
  21. and sprinkle with Cheddar cheese. Serve warm.

Prep Time: 20 mins

Cook Time: 15 mins

Total Time: 3 hrs 5 mins

Servings: 30
